The Houston Rockets (9-5) will host the Toronto Raptors (8-6) on Wednesday night. Here is how to watch this NBA game online.

There are 12 games on tap in the NBA on Wednesday night. One of those games will be between the Toronto Raptors (8-6) and the Houston Rockets (9-5). Tipoff from the Toyota Center in Houston will be at 8:00 p.m. ET.

Root Sports Southwest will have the game in Greater Houston. The Sports Network (TSN) will carry the game in Toronto. Since this game will not be nationally televised in the United States, the available live stream can be found on NBA League Pass, which requires a subscription.

Toronto enters play at 8-6 on the year, tied with the Boston Celtics for the best record in the Atlantic Division. The Raptors have lost two straight games, have gone 5-5 in their last 10, and a 4-3 away from the Air Canada Centre this season.

Houston enters play at 9-5 on the year, tied for second place in the Southwest Division with the Memphis Grizzlies. The Rockets trail the San Antonio Spurs by two games in the division. Houston has won three straight games, is 7-3 in its last 10 games, and is 4-1 at home this season.

According to OddsShark.com, the Rockets will be four points at home to the visiting Raptors. The associated moneylines are Houston -165 and Toronto +145. This game’s over/under comes in at a combined 216.5 points.

The Seven Seconds or Less offense of Mike D’Antoni has worked wonderfully so far with the 2016-17 Rockets. Defensively, this team will give up points. The Raptors do have an elite mid-range shooter in shooting guard DeMar DeRozan. Either team can win this game. These seem to be two evenly matched NBA teams here in late November.
